Formula used

Pythagorean: A=1…I=9, J=1…R=9, S=1…Z=8; sum all letters and reduce

The Pythagorean system maps each letter to 1–9 by its position (looping every nine letters). Sum the values of every letter in the name and reduce to a single digit, keeping master numbers 11, 22 and 33.

Example calculation

Worked example

ALEX: A=1, L=3, E=5, X=6 → sum 15 → 1+5 = 6, "Harmony".

Add a surname and the total changes — the full name gives your complete "expression number".

The number in your name

Name numerology assigns a number to your name — often called the "expression" or "destiny" number — by converting each letter to a digit and reducing the sum. The most common method is the Pythagorean system, which loops the alphabet through 1 to 9. The resulting number is said to describe your talents and character, complementing the life-path number that comes from your birth date.

As with all numerology, this is a belief system rather than a science: there's no evidence that the letters of a name shape who you are, and the trait descriptions are broad enough to feel personal to almost anyone. But it's a genuinely fun exercise — comparing the numbers of your full name, nickname and family members, or seeing how a name change shifts the result. Enjoy it as a playful, reflective lens, take the traits that resonate as food for thought, and hold the rest lightly.

Frequently asked questions

How is a name number calculated?

Using the Pythagorean system: each letter maps to a number 1–9 by its alphabet position (A=1 through I=9, then J=1 again), you sum all the letters, and reduce to a single digit — keeping master numbers 11, 22 and 33.

What's the difference between a name number and a life path number?

A name number (expression number) comes from the letters of your name; a life path number comes from your birth date. Numerology treats them as complementary — one for your character and talents, the other for your life's journey.

Is name numerology real?

No — it's a belief system, not science. There's no evidence that a name's letters determine personality. It's an entertaining, reflective lens best enjoyed as a game, much like a horoscope.
